what does precise mean
measurements are consistent, they fluctuate slightly about a mean value- precise does not mean accurate
what does repeatability mean
if the original experimenter can redo the experiment with the same equipment and method and get the same results its repeatable
what does reproducibility mean
if the experiment is redone by a different person or with different techniques and equipment and same result is found it is reproducible
what does resolution mean
the smallest change in the quantity being measured that gives a recognisable change in reading
what does accuracy mean
a measurement clos to the true value is accurate
how can you reduce fractional or percentage uncertainty
measure larger quantities
what is a reading and what are the rules of uncertainties in them
readings are when one value is found and the uncertainty is equal to half the smallest division
what are measurements and what are the uncertainties in them
measurement are the difference between two readings and the uncertainty is the smallest division
what is the uncertainty for digital readings
its resolution
what is the uncertainty for repeated data
half the range
how you do combine uncertainties for adding or subtracting data
always add the absolute uncertainties
how do you combine uncertainties when multiplying or dividing
add the percentage uncertainties
